Common Problems with Your Home Water Heater
Think of starting your day without your regular warm shower. That already sets a bad tone for the rest of your day.
Every house needs a reliable water heater, however just a couple of know just how to manage one. One simple way to maintain your water heater in leading shape is to look for mistakes on a regular basis and fix them as quickly as they show up.
Keep in mind to switch off your water heater prior to sniffing around for faults. These are the hot water heater mistakes you are more than likely to encounter.

Water too hot or too cold


Every water heater has a thermostat that figures out exactly how warm the water gets. If the water entering your home is too hot despite establishing a hassle-free optimum temperature level, your thermostat may be defective.
On the other hand, too cold water might result from a stopped working thermostat, a broken circuit, or inappropriate gas flow. As an example, if you use a gas water heater with a busted pilot light, you would get cold water, even if the thermostat remains in perfect condition. For electrical heaters, a blown fuse may be the perpetrator.

Not nearly enough hot water


Water heaters been available in lots of dimensions, relying on your hot water demands. If you run out of hot water before everyone has had a bath, your water heater is too little for your family size. You ought to think about setting up a larger hot water heater tank or selecting a tankless water heater, which occupies less room and also is extra resilient.

Weird noises


There are at the very least 5 sort of sounds you can learn through a hot water heater, yet one of the most typical analysis is that it's time for the water heater to retire.
Firstly, you must recognize with the normal sounds a hot water heater makes. An electrical heating unit may appear various from a gas-powered one.
Popping or banging sounds generally indicate there is a slab of debris in your storage tanks, and it's time to cleanse it out. On the other hand, whistling or hissing noises might just be your valves allowing some pressure off.

Water leakages


Leaks might come from pipes, water links, valves, or in the worst-case circumstance, the tank itself. With time, water will corrode the tank, and also find its escape. If this occurs, you need to change your water heater asap.
However, before your modification your entire container, be sure that all pipes are in location which each shutoff works flawlessly. If you still require help determining a leak, call your plumber.

Rust-colored water


Rust-colored water means one of your hot water heater parts is worn away. Maybe the anode rod, or the storage tank itself. Your plumber will be able to identify which it is.

Lukewarm water


Despite just how high you established the thermostat, you won't get any hot water out of a heating system well past its prime. A hot water heater's performance may minimize with time.
You will certainly likewise get lukewarm water if your pipelines have a cross link. This suggests that when you turn on a faucet, hot water from the heater flows in alongside normal, cold water. A cross link is simple to area. If your hot water taps still pursue closing the water heater valves, you have a cross connection.

Discoloured Water


Rust is a significant root cause of dirty or discoloured water. Deterioration within the water storage tank or a failing anode pole could create this discolouration. The anode rod secures the tank from rusting on the within and must be examined yearly. Without a pole or a correctly working anode pole, the hot water swiftly wears away inside the tank. Get in touch with a specialist water heater specialist to identify if replacing the anode rod will fix the problem; if not, change your hot water heater.

Verdict


Preferably, your water heater can last 10 years prior to you require a modification. Nevertheless, after the 10-year mark, you may experience any one of these mistakes much more frequently. At this point, you need to include a new hot water heater to your budget plan.

Common Water Heater Problems & Their Causes


What Causes A Water Heater To Leak?


In many cases, corrosion is the main cause of a leaking tank, but only a licensed plumber will be able to accurately identify the issue. So if you start to notice pools of water collecting around your water heater, contact your local plumbing company right away. A leaking water heater is not something you will want to ignore because small water heater problems can turn into big issues overnight. There is a good chance you will need to completely replace your current water heater, either because it’s too old or has become damaged and significantly less efficient.


Why Is My Water Heater Making Noise?


A noisy water heater can be the result of a few different things. Things like sediment and mineral deposits are known to gather at the bottom of water heater tanks. When the sediment and mineral deposits are heated, it can result in a “bang” or “pop” sound. If you’re looking for a way to effectively combat your noisy water heater, you may want to consider investing in a water treatment system to help filter out sediment and mineral deposits.


Why Does My Water Smell Like Sulfur?


If the water coming out of your kitchen or bathroom faucet has a stinky smell to it, the water likely has bacteria in it, which has accumulated in your hot water tank. If you live in an area of town that uses well water, this may be something you deal with on a regular basis. One way to try and fix this issue is to periodically flush out your water heater. This may help eliminate the sulfur or rotten egg smell from your home’s water.
